The distribution intramural lymph vessels of trachea in the guinea pig and the rabbit were examined by light and electron microscopy. The tracheal mucosal layer was provided with lymphatic capillary networks. Both capillary and collecting vessels were found in the submucosal, the muscular and the adventitia tunics. Lymphatic present percentage (guinea pig 36%; rabbit 23%; P <0.01) were examined in 320 section of tracheal organic tissues. Maximum diameter [guinea pig: 22.6±14.1μm( ±s ); rabbit: 23.7±14.9μm( ±s ) were measured by Olympus light microscopy fixed micrometer. Volume density [guinea pig: 2.05±0.49μm 3/μm 3×10 -3 ( ±s ); rabbit: 1.29±0.40μm 3/μm 3×10 -3 ( ±s )] and number density [guinea pig: 5.89±1.20Ly/mm 2( ±s ); rabbit: 2.32±0.58 Ly/mm 2 ( ±s )] of tracheal lymph vessels were determined by a computer image analyzer system. The density of tracheal lymph vessels in guinea pig was greater than that in rabbit. The lymphatic capillaries observed by electron microscopy in this study were structurally similar between guinea pig and rabbit. The nonfenestrated endothelium was thin and lacked a continuous basal lamina. The endothelial cells were joined to each other by three types of intercellular junctions end to end, overlapping and interdigitating. There were large vesicles in endotheliocyte.
